It is everyone’s dream to become famous. But did you know that fame comes at a cost? VICKY WANDAWA talked to Juliana Kanyomozi, a local artiste, about life in the limelight
People tend to judge you in a certain way. There is a certain image they have of celebrities, which in most cases, is wrong. Every time I meet someone for the first time, they are completely surprised that I am the complete opposite of what they expected to find. I miss the freedom of being able to do anything without worrying about being judged.
Naturally, I am a simple person, who likes to do simple things, but apparently, celebrities are not expected to be simple, which I find ridiculous.
Nonetheless, being in the limelight has enabled me to meet different people. And they are so loving and kind to me everywhere I go. But mostly, it is a platform to use my music to touch people’s lives positively.
